Central American vs Creek Unemployment Among Women with Children Ages 6 to 17 years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 342,192,933 people shows a poor positive correlation between the proportion of Central Americans and unemployment rate among women with children between the ages 6 and 17 in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.104 and weighted average of 9.4%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 148,406,734 people shows a weak positive correlation between the proportion of Creek and unemployment rate among women with children between the ages 6 and 17 in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.277 and weighted average of 9.4%, a difference of 0.090%.
